Priority Meal Program recipient of Aging Achievement Award

Coastline Elderly Services’ Priority Meal Program is honored to be the recipient of an Aging Achievement Award in the Nutrition category from The National Association of Area Agencies on Aging .

The award will be presented on Sunday July 17, 2011 at the annual n4a conference in Washington, DC.

Coastline Elderly Nutrition Priority Meals Program provides hot nutritional meals to HIV/AIDS consumers. It is funded under the Commonwealth of Massachusetts Department of Public Health.

The following services are also available to participants of the program:

  1. Nutrition Education
  2. Information of other services and referral to other agencies serving the HIV/AIDS community with written authorization from the consumer.
  3. Nutrition Supplement

HOW DO I GET PRIORITY MEALS?
A letter of support from your doctor is the first step in getting on the program.

You must then contact us directly at Coastline Elderly Services, Inc. 508-999-6400 ext.194 or ext. 188 or you may go through an agency that is already providing other services for you. They will call in a referral to us for meals. We accept referrals from:

  • Doctors
  • Hospitals
  • Local VNA’s
  • PACE
  • Center for Health & Human Services
  • N.B. Child & Family Services
  • PAACA
  • Catholic Social Services
  • Healing Light Productions
  • Movable Feast
  • Immigrants Assistance Center
  • Any Other Social Service Agency
